On 2022/1/29 16:21, Chao Yu wrote: > In a fragmented image, entries in dnode block list may locate in > incontiguous physical block address space, however, in recovery flow, > we will always readahead BIO_MAX_VECS size blocks, so in such case, > current readahead policy is low efficient, let's adjust readahead > window size dynamically based on consecutiveness of dnode blocks. > > Signed-off-by: Chao Yu <chao@kernel.org> > --- > fs/f2fs/checkpoint.c | 8 ++++++-- > fs/f2fs/f2fs.h | 6 +++++- > fs/f2fs/recovery.c | 27 ++++++++++++++++++++++++--- > 3 files changed, 35 insertions(+), 6 deletions(-) > > diff --git a/fs/f2fs/checkpoint.c b/fs/f2fs/checkpoint.c > index 57a2d9164bee..203a1577942d 100644 > --- a/fs/f2fs/checkpoint.c > +++ b/fs/f2fs/checkpoint.c > @@ -282,18 +282,22 @@ int f2fs_ra_meta_pages(struct f2fs_sb_info *sbi, block_t start, int nrpages, > return blkno - start;
